It is beyond the scope of this post to cover every you can possibly imagine combination of household situations, however here is a general format for a typically worded invitation, with some typical alternatives italicized and explained in surrounding notes: Keep in mind that complete very first names and middle names are used (no nicknames!), and nothing is abbreviated other than titles like Mr - free wedding invitation maker., Mrs., Dr.

The bride's name is listed prior to the groom's, the groom has a title (Mr.) however the bride-to-be does not. The British spelling of the word "honour" is utilized for a church event - calla lily wedding invitation. State names, years, dates and times are all written out fully, and note that "half after 4 o'clock" is utilized instead of "four-thirty." Commas are used only to separate the day and date, and the city and state.

The RSVP deadline on your reaction card need to be one month before your wedding event date, so that you have enough time to determine seating plans, then have escort cards and location cards printed. Here is an example of a standard reaction card: The favour of a reply is requested before the twenty-sixth of AugustM will attendM will be unable to go to Keep in mind the English spelling of the word "favour." Reaction cards need to never ever request the number of guests pertaining to the weddinginstead, the specific names of guests who are being invited are suggested on your envelope( s), and those visitors who can concern the wedding event will so indicate by composing their names in the proper blank on the card.

Many couples drop the traditional "M" in front of the blank line, so visitors can compose their names more delicately. indian wedding invitation cards. A pre-addressed, stamped envelope accompanies the more conventional form of reaction card, however some contemporary versions are developed as a postcard, with the address and mark put on the rear end of the card.

Because a directions card is a fairly recent advancement, there are no rigid guidelines concerning its format. You can offer the details either in the type of specific composed instructions, or additionally you can supply a detailed map.

Depending on your specific circumstances, you may be required to offer any or all of the following sort of information: Valet parkingIf this is being supplied, it ought to be suggested right away following the driving directions. Group transport plans you have made for your guestsIndicate where and when your visitors require to meet to take the transport, and in setting a departure time, permit an additional 15 minutes to ensure an on-time arrival.

Childcare plans that you have madeA excellent method to encourage guests with children to go to, while keeping the kids from crashing your party, if that's your preference. Appropriate attire for the weddingFor example, "black tie" for a formal wedding event, or "garden shoes recommended" for an outside wedding event where you do not want the ladies aerating the yard with spiked heels.

Other things to doIf it's a destination wedding, you might desire to provide info on area destinations. The hosts of the wedding event need to be listed here. This can be the bride-to-be's moms and dads, the groom's parents, both, or neither. For more casual phrasing, the moms and dad's first and last names can be noted instead of using titles. For instance: Cheryl and William Lewis (the female's name is noted initially, as the guy's given name must not be separated from his surname).
